Professional Designer Notes for Implementation

Before committing to this asset for a commercial project, I recommend the following checks:

  1. Test in Black and White: Convert the design to grayscale to evaluate the visual hierarchy. If the box loses its form or impact without color, the line weight and structure may need adjustment.
  2. Check Contrast on Light and Dark Backgrounds: Verify how the asset behaves against both light and dark surfaces. Some designs require a stroke or shadow effect to pop against dark backgrounds.
  3. Preview at Multiple Sizes: Look at the asset on a mobile screen and a printed flyer. Details that look good on a desktop monitor may vanish on a business card.
  4. Review Font Pairings: Experiment with different font styles to see what complements the box. A script font might enhance the handmade feel, while a sans serif font could modernize the look. Avoid pairing it with overly ornate display fonts that compete for attention.
  5. Confirm Commercial Licensing: Always read the license agreement. Ensure you have the right to use the asset for client work, merchandise, and resale. Commercial license terms vary widely, and violating them can lead to legal issues.
  6. Inspect Transparency and Edges: If using the PNG version, zoom in to check for jagged edges or halo artifacts around the window cutout. Clean edges are non-negotiable for professional results.
